Nicolas SARRAZIN was born 10 February 1686 in Montmagny, Canada, New France

Nicolas SARRAZIN was the child of Nicolas SARAZIN DEPELTEAU   and   Marie-Catherine BLONDEAU and the grandchild of: (maternal)  François BLONDEAU and Marie-Nicole ROLLAND DEPELTEAU

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Nicolas  married  Marie-Louise JUILLET 25 November 1715 in Montréal, Canada, New France .  Marie-Louise JUILLET  was born 2 April 1699 in Montréal, Québec, Canada (Sault-au-Récollet) (Côte-St-Michel) (Côte-St-Paul).  Marie-Louise died 25 November 1789 in Montréal, Québec, Canada (Sault-au-Récollet) (Côte-St-Michel) (Côte-St-Paul).  Marie-Louise was the child of Louis JUILLET and Catherine CELLE dite DUCLOS.

Nicolas SARRAZIN died 9 March 1765 in Montréal, Province of Québec,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
